Background
The purpose of the SCC project is to establish a Social Contract Advisory, Monitoring and Coordination Center within the Information and Decision Support Center (IDSC) at the Prime Minister’s Office. The Social Contract Center will work closely with other IDSC units to provide first class policy advice and policy options, monitoring the implementation of the MDGs-based poverty action plan --as proposed in the EHDR2005 and adopted by the government as the national development plan,-- as well as coordinating with various stakeholders to define, develop and articulate a vision for a new social contract and a paradigm shift in state-citizen relationship, in Egypt, rooted in principles of democratic governance and modern concepts of citizenship.
The Governance team, within the Social Contract Centre is working on 4 major focus areas:
1) Development of a nationally-owned governance assessment framework for development in Egypt 
2) Conducting a Governance in Sectors assessment and data set
3) Consolidate a thorough Anti-corruption research agenda and action plan
4) Develop and implement a Local Governance Index in Egypt
